Synergy effect of CuO on CuCo<sub>2</sub>O<sub>4</sub> for methane catalytic combustion

Abstract

CuO and CuCo 2 O 4 exhibit a synergistic effect in catalyzing methane combustion, which increases the oxidation rate of methane on the surface of (CuO) 0.2 –CuCo 2 O 4 composite oxide and decreasing the methane combustion temperature.
